Frequent Garage Door Issues and Their Solutions

Garage doors, a vital component of home security and convenience, often encounter various issues that can disrupt their functionality. One prevalent concern is the door's inability to open or close appropriately, usually stemming from tracks that are out of alignment or malfunctioning sensors. In such cases, realigning the tracks or cleaning the sensors can resolve the issue. An additional common problem is the door producing excessive noise, generally because of deteriorated rollers or hinges, which can be corrected by applying lubricant to the components or substituting them when needed. Moreover, springs might snap, causing the door to become unusable; substituting these springs is crucial for safe performance. In conclusion, a faulty remote control might impede access, which can usually be fixed by installing new batteries or resetting the device. Resolving these typical garage door problems quickly ensures security and preserves the door's operation.

Indicators You Require Professional Repair Services

When property owners observe abnormal noises or irregular movements from their garage doors, it commonly points to the need for professional repair services. Grinding, popping, or squeaking sounds can point to degraded rollers or tracks that are out of alignment. Moreover, if the door closes or opens irregularly, it may signal issues with the springs or cables, jeopardizing the door's safety and functionality.

Another sign demanding professional attention is the door's failure to respond to the opener or wall switch; this might suggest electrical problems. Homeowners should also be vigilant to visible damage, such as dents or rust, which can influence both aesthetics and functionality. Lastly, if the door suddenly reverses or won't remain closed, it poses a security threat. Addressing these problems immediately through professional repair services can ensure the safety and reliability of the garage door.

Strengthening Your Garage Door Security Features

Making certain safe operation of garage doors is just one part of upholding a protected home environment. Strengthening garage door security features is vital for securing a property from potential intruders. Homeowners are encouraged to invest in robust locking mechanisms, such as smart locks or deadbolts, which deliver an additional layer of security. Additionally, automatic garage door openers incorporating rolling code technology can stop unauthorized access by changing the access code each time the door is used.

Placing security cameras near the garage entrance can also serve as a deterrent against theft. Furthermore, incorporating motion-sensor lights around the garage area improves visibility at night, reducing the risk of break-ins. Regular maintenance of these security features, including checking for vulnerabilities, ensures their effectiveness. By adopting these measures, homeowners can substantially enhance their garage door security, supporting the overall safety of their home.

What Is the Duration of a Standard Garage Door Repair?

A typical garage door repair normally requires between one to three hours, depending on the complexity of the issue. Elements such as part availability and technician expertise can also impact the overall repair duration.

How Much Do Garage Door Repair Services Cost?

Prices for garage door repair services can vary greatly, commonly ranging from $100 to $500. Considerations determining pricing include the form of repair essential, parts demanded, and labor costs, with emergency services commonly commanding higher fees.
